(a) Pixel Tags, also known as a clear GIF or web beacon, is an invisible tag placed on certain pages of the Website but not on your device. When you access these pages, pixel tags generate a generic notice of that visit. They usually work when a particular device visits a particular page. RDW Design Studio uses pixel tags for website analytics, to serve you more relevant content and promotional offers based upon your historical behavioral patterns.
(b) Your network service provider normally assigns a dynamic IP address to you every time you use your mobile browser. We collect your mobile device’s IP address in order to conduct system administration, Mobile Site analysis, block devices that are intending to hack or otherwise damage our Mobile Site, and identify devices which may be engaged in illegal or illicit activity on our Mobile Site. While we do not associate IP addresses with records containing Personal Information, we will use IP addresses to identify any user who engages in misconduct or otherwise violates any applicable laws. Additionally, we may be required to disclose IP addresses pursuant to a court order or subpoena. RDW Design Studio may also identify and track your Internet protocol (“IP”) address. An IP address is the unique number assigned to your server or internet service provider (“ISP”). RDW Design Studio may track those IP addresses for system administration purposes, to report aggregate information, site tracking, security purposes, or to prevent our data and servers from being damaged.

6. What are cookies and how do we use them?
A cookie is a small bit of computer code that we send to your computer and is stored on your hard drive. It allows a website to transfer bits of information to your computer for record-keeping purposes. A cookie stored in your computer can be used to “remember” specific data items such as your password or operational information, such as the fact that you have already subscribed to the full version of a particular online game. That allows us to speed up your future activities, saving the time you would normally spend entering information such as your password or subscription information. 12. What are your data protection rights?
All Website users are entitled to the following:
Access – you have the right to request copies of your personal data. We may charge you a reasonable fee for this service.
Rectification – you have the right to request We correct any of your data you believe is inaccurate, or to complete information that is incomplete.
Erasure – you have the right to request We delete your data, under certain conditions.
Restrict Processing – you have the right to request We restrict the processing of your data, under certain conditions.
Object to Processing – you have the right to object to Our processing your data, under certain conditions.
Data Portability – you have the right to request We transfer the data we have collected to another organization, or directly to you, under certain conditions.

15. Data Privacy Statement for Google Analytics.
This website uses Google Analytics, a web analytics service provided by Google, Inc. (“Google”). Google Analytics uses “cookies”, which are text files placed on your computer, to help the website analyze how users use the site. The information generated by the cookie about your use of the website (including your anonymized IP address) will be transmitted to and stored by Google on servers in the United States. Google will use this information for the purpose of evaluating your use of the website, compiling reports on website activity for website operators and providing other services relating to website activity and internet usage. Google may also transfer this information to third parties where required to do so by law, or where such third parties process the information on Google’s behalf. Google will not associate your IP address with any other data held by Google. You may refuse the use of cookies by selecting the appropriate settings on your browser; however, please note that if you do this you may not be able to use the full functionality of this website.
